Abstract
The utility model belongs to coalcutter equipment technical field, more particularly to a kind of large-scale coalcutter rack extracting tool, solve the problems, such as large-scale coalcutter rack in demolishing process without effective removal tool, including hydraulic cylinder and extracting tool frame body, hydraulic cylinder is arranged in extracting tool frame body and hydraulic cylinder is connected with hydraulic power unit by oil pipe, extracting tool frame body includes two pieces of symmetrically arranged limiting plates, it is fixedly connected with brace steel post between limiting plate is rectangular and two pieces of limiting plates, brace steel post is symmetricly set on the side of limiting plate, it is symmetrically provided with limit hole on the other side plate body of limiting plate, gag lever post is connected in limit hole, extracting tool frame body can be connected to the drift position of coalcutter rack by gag lever post.The utility model simple structure and reasonable design, dismantling is flexible, and device is light, and controllability is high.

Specific implementation mode
The utility model is further elaborated in referring to Fig.1~Fig. 5, a kind of large size coalcutter rack extracting tool, packet
Hydraulic cylinder 6 and extracting tool frame body 2 are included, the setting of hydraulic cylinder 6 is in extracting tool frame body 2 and hydraulic cylinder 6 passes through oil pipe 5
It is connected with hydraulic power unit 1, extracting tool frame body 2 includes two pieces of symmetrically arranged limiting plates 2.1, and limiting plate 2.1 is rectangular and two
Brace steel post 2.2 is fixedly connected between block limiting plate 2.1, brace steel post 2.2 is symmetricly set on the side of limiting plate 2.1, limit
It is symmetrically provided with limit hole 2.5 on the other side plate body of plate 2.1, gag lever post 2.4 is connected in limit hole 2.5, gag lever post 2.4 can
Extracting tool frame body 2 is connected to 4 position of drift of coalcutter rack 3.
Brace steel post 2.2 is symmetrically arranged two square columns, the outside connection position of brace steel post 2.2 and limiting plate 2.1
It installs and is equipped with stiffener plate 2.3, stiffener plate 2.3 is triangular steel plate.Brace steel post 2.2 is in the side towards limit hole 2.5
It is connected with the cylinder body of hydraulic cylinder 6, for the piston rod of hydraulic cylinder 6 towards 2.4 direction of gag lever post, the piston rod of hydraulic cylinder 6 is straight
Diameter is less than the spacing of two gag lever posts 2.4, and the both ends of gag lever post 2.4 are provided with pin hole, pin is connected in pin hole.
The dismounting power of the utility model is ensured to carry by hydraulic power unit 1, mating oil pipe 5 and double acting hydraulic cylinder composition
For enough power, meet the underground work requirement dismantled at any time.
The limiting plate 2.1 of extracting tool frame body 2 is process using the steel plate of thickness 20mm, and brace steel post 2.2 is using high
Intensity square steel is simultaneously welded and fixed in limiting plate 2.1, and three are welded in the outside contact site of brace steel post 2.2 and limiting plate 2.1
Angular stiffener plate 2.3.
The utility model by extracting tool frame body 2 by, mounted on 4 position of drift of coalcutter rack 3, utilizing hydraulic pump
It stands and 1 provides power so that the flexible dismounting for holding out against drift 4 and eject the realization rack of coalcutter rack 3 of hydraulic cylinder 6.Tool
The installation process of body is that symmetrically arranged limiting plate 2.1 on extracting tool frame body 2 is first snapped fit onto 3 drift 4 of coalcutter rack
Corresponding position is installed gag lever post 2.4 and is fixed using pin hole and pin so that gag lever post 2.4 blocks with coalcutter rack 3
It connects, the piston rod for ensureing hydraulic cylinder 6 and the drift 4 of coalcutter rack 3 are located at same straight line;In extracting tool frame body 2
Hydraulic cylinder 6 is provided on side brace steel post 2.2, under the driving of hydraulic power unit 1, the piston rod of hydraulic cylinder 6 is towards drift 4
Direction movement, and held out against in the small head end of the drift of drift 4 4.1, drift 4 finally forced to be detached from realization from coalcutter rack 3
The dismounting of coalcutter rack 3.It must ensure that the Impact direction of hydraulic cylinder 6 and drift 4 is along drift microcephaly in disassembly process
End 4.1 is to the direction of drift stub end 4.2.
